In addition to what greg sahli suggests, also issue the commands:
chmod 1777 /var/tmp
chown root:wheel /var/tmp
My commands and greg sahli's suggestions ASSUME that you did not delete other things essential for the normal operation of Mac OS X.
Otherwise you will have to follow mende1's advice and reinstall Mac OS X.

-MichelleI know it's late but maybe it will help other people.
I ran into the same issue and none of the solutions listed by apple helped.
I booted into single-user mode and I read the log in /Volumes/Macintosh\ HD/private/var/log/system.log, it was full of errors like theses
Dec 30 18:03:28 MacBook-Air locationd[352]: libcoreservices: _dirhelper: 454: mkdir: path=/var/folders/zz/zyxvpxvq6csfxvn_n00000sm00006d/C/ modes[2]=0700: No such file or directory
Dec 30 18:03:28 MacBook-Air.local locationd[352]: could not create persistent store directory (Input/output error)
Dec 30 18:03:28 MacBook-Air locationd[352]: libcoreservices: _dirhelper: 454: mkdir: path=/var/folders/zz/zyxvpxvq6csfxvn_n00000sm00006d/C/ modes[2]=0700: No such file or directory
The system actually tried to create directories in /var/folders but the directory /var/folders did not exists, so I created it:
Under single-user mode:
mount -o update /
cd /Volumes/Macintosh\ HD/
mkdir var/folders
mkdir var/folders/zz
reboot
And it booted just fine ! -

Any chance of restoring that profiles.ini file via the Time Machine?
*http://kb.mozillazine.org/profiles.ini_file
If not then you need to use the Profile Manager to re-register that no longer recognized profile.<br />
You do that by creating a new profile and use Choose Location to point the your lost profile.
*http://kb.mozillazine.org/Profile_in_use
*http://kb.mozillazine.org/Recovering_a_missing_profile -

Bad news first and we hope for good news as well
The device is in Recovery Mode and the data has already been deleted, you need to restore the device with iTunes in order to get the iPhone back into a working state
When the iPhone is restored you can then restore it from your latest backup using iTunes or iCloud and regain some, if not all, of your data.
The good news part only happens if you had a backup.
